Mountain biking around Osieck, located in Poland's Masovian Voivodeship, offers access to extensive forested areas and a network of cycling routes. The region is characterized by its lush landscapes, with over 20% covered by pine and oak forests, providing a natural setting for rides. This forested terrain offers ample shade and a tranquil environment for mountain biking, with a well-developed network of routes.

Railway station located in Celestynów in the municipality of Celestynów. The station is located on the Vistula railway line from Warsaw East to Dorohusk (railway line No. 7). In the area of the station, there is a historic building with a ticket office and waiting room of Koleje Mazowieckie. In the area of the station, there is also the Celestynów (Cl) signal box building.

The bunkers in Dąbrowiecka Górka are among the best-preserved military objects from World War I and II in the Masovian Landscape Park. Additionally, they belong to the fortifications trail of the Warsaw Bridgehead 1915-1944.

The best-known and best-camouflaged object of this type in the Mazovian Landscape Park are the bunkers on Dąbrowiecka Góra (also called Biała Góra), which are remnants of German fortifications from 1944 (the so-called Warsaw Bridgehead).

Frequently Asked Questions

How many mountain bike trails are available around Osieck?

There are over 30 mountain bike trails around Osieck, offering a variety of options for riders. These routes cover a substantial distance, providing ample opportunities to explore the region's forested landscapes.

What kind of terrain can I expect on mountain bike trails near Osieck?

The trails around Osieck are primarily characterized by lush landscapes and extensive forested areas, dominated by pine and oak. You can expect a mix of terrain, with some segments potentially unpaved, offering a natural and often tranquil setting for cycling. The region's network includes varied terrain, from gravel paths to more natural forest floors.

What is the overall difficulty level of mountain biking in Osieck?

The mountain biking routes in Osieck cater to various skill levels. You'll find 17 easy trails perfect for beginners or those seeking a relaxed ride, and 13 moderate trails for riders looking for a bit more challenge. There are no routes classified as difficult, making the area accessible for most mountain bikers.

Are there any easy mountain bike trails suitable for beginners in Osieck?

Yes, Osieck offers several easy mountain bike trails perfect for beginners. One such route is the Celestynów railway station – Monument to the Struggle for Polish Rails loop from Celestynów, which is 23.6 km long and takes approximately 1 hour 27 minutes to complete. This trail provides a gentle introduction to the region's scenic beauty.

Are there longer mountain bike routes for more experienced riders?

For those seeking a longer ride, the Celestynów railway station – Żółw Lake and Shelters loop from Celestynów is a moderate 67.0 km trail that leads through extensive forested areas. It typically takes about 4 hours 18 minutes to complete, offering a more extended adventure through the region.

Can I find circular mountain bike routes around Osieck?

Many of the mountain bike trails around Osieck are designed as loops, allowing you to start and end your ride in the same location. An example is the Pond with a Bench – Wayside shrine loop from Zabieżki, a moderate 26.7 km route that offers a scenic circular journey.

Are there mountain bike trails in Osieck that pass by interesting sights or attractions?

Yes, some trails incorporate historical sites and natural attractions. For instance, the Bunkers on Dąbrowiecka Góra – Gravel Ascent loop from Celestynów features historical sites like the Dąbrowiecka Góra Fortified Skansen within a forested setting. You can also find routes near the impressive ruins of the Castle of the Masovian Dukes in Czersk, offering a blend of outdoor activity and cultural exploration.

Are there places to stop for refreshments or food near the trails?

Yes, the region is becoming more cyclist-friendly. You can find establishments like Góra Café, which caters to bikers and offers convenient refreshment stops. It's always a good idea to check the specific route for nearby amenities.

What is the best time of year for mountain biking in Osieck?

The lush landscapes and extensive forests of Osieck make it enjoyable for mountain biking through much of the year. Spring and autumn offer pleasant temperatures and beautiful scenery, with changing foliage. Summer provides ample shade from the pine and oak forests, making it comfortable even on warmer days. Always check local weather conditions before heading out.

What do other mountain bikers say about the trails in Osieck?

The mountain bike trails in Osieck are high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.3 stars from over 20 reviews. Riders often praise the tranquil environment, the extensive network of routes through the forests, and the variety of options available for different skill levels.

Is parking available near the mountain bike trails in Osieck?

While specific parking facilities for every trailhead are not detailed, Osieck and its surrounding areas are generally accessible. Many routes start from towns like Celestynów or Zabieżki, where public parking options are typically available. It's advisable to check the starting point of your chosen route for the most convenient parking.

Are there any natural landmarks or scenic viewpoints along the mountain bike routes?

Yes, the region boasts diverse and picturesque scenery. You might encounter natural highlights such as the Turtle Pond or the Czarne Jeziorka. The forested terrain itself provides many scenic spots, especially within areas like the Bagno Bocianowskie Nature Reserve.
